Iveco participates in the Tour d’Europe 2025, an initiative involving the entire European automotive value chain, with more than 20 partners, whose objective is to raise awareness about the role of renewable fuels in achieving climate neutrality by 2050, as outlined in the European Green Deal.
Iveco joins the Tour, which began last March in Madrid, with its new S-Way LNG truck powered by biomethane. The company is actively demonstrating that renewable gas effectively reduces CO2 emissions and offers a concrete and scalable solution for decarbonizing commercial road transport. Thanks to a well-established and expanding European refueling network of around 800 stations, it is now possible to cover international routes with a truck powered exclusively by Bio-LNG.
Until June, the project’s commercial vehicles powered by biomethane, HVO, and bioethanol will tour Europe, with events fostering dialogue between supply chain stakeholders and policymakers on the effectiveness of renewable fuels and their decarbonization potential for the transport sector.
